Add-ons in bike insurance policy
The various kinds of two-wheeler insurance add-on covers include:
Zero depreciation cover, also known as bumper-to-bumper insurance, is an add-on cover in two-wheeler insurance that ensures full claim settlement without factoring in depreciation. Typically, when a bike undergoes repairs, insurers deduct depreciation costs on replaced parts reducing the claim amount.
However, with zero depreciation cover, the insurer covers the entire repair cost. This add-on is especially beneficial for new bikes, as it minimises out-of-pocket expenses in case of damage. Though it comes with a higher premium, it provides financial security and peace of mind by ensuring maximum claim benefits.

Roadside assistance cover
This add-on cover in two-wheeler insurance provides immediate help if your bike breaks down while riding. It includes services like towing, minor repairs, flat tire assistance, fuel delivery and battery jump-starts.
This add-on ensures that you get quick support without extra costs during emergencies, reducing stress and inconvenience. It is especially useful for long rides and remote areas where finding help can be difficult.
One of the major bike-insurance add-ons, engine protection cover, provides financial protection against damage to your bike's engine due to water ingression, oil leakage or mechanical breakdown.
This add-on is beneficial, especially for those living in flood-prone areas or frequently riding through waterlogged roads.
This cover in bike insurance is an add-on that covers the cost of consumable items like engine oil, nuts, bolts, grease, brake oil and similar components that need replacement after an accident.
Normally, these expenses are not covered under a standard bike insurance policy. However, these costs are reimbursed with this cover. This helps reduce out-of-pocket expenses during repairs. This add-on is especially beneficial for expensive bikes.
